Prayers for Divine Protection and Safety
When we commit our family’s safety to God’s care, we’re acknowledging that true security comes not from our own efforts, but from the Almighty’s watchful eye. These prayers create a hedge of protection around your household.
Prayer 1: Lord, surround our family with Your angels this year. Keep us safe from harm, accidents, and evil influences. In Jesus’ name, Amen.
Related Verse: Psalm 91:11 – “For he will command his angels concerning you to guard you in all your ways.” This promise assures us that divine intervention is actively working in our daily lives, providing supernatural protection beyond human understanding.
Prayer 2: Heavenly Father, be our fortress and refuge. When storms come, let our home remain a place of peace and safety for all.**
Related Verse: Psalm 91:2 – “I will say of the Lord, ‘He is my refuge and my fortress, my God, in whom I trust.'” This verse establishes our confidence in God’s protective nature, making Him our ultimate security.
Prayer 3: God, protect our family during travel and daily activities. Guide our steps and bring us safely home each day. Amen.
Related Verse: Psalm 121:8 – “The Lord will watch over your coming and going both now and forevermore.” This covenant promise covers every aspect of our movement and activity, ensuring divine guidance in all circumstances.
Prayer 4: Lord Jesus, shield our minds from negativity and our hearts from fear. Fill our home with Your presence and light.**
Related Verse: 2 Timothy 1:7 – “For God has not given us a spirit of fear, but of power, love and sound mind.” This empowers families to walk in courage rather than anxiety, knowing God’s strength sustains us.
Prayer 5: Almighty God, protect our family’s reputation, relationships, and testimony. Let our lives glorify You in every interaction this year. Amen.
Related Verse: Matthew 5:16 – “Let your light shine before others, that they may see your good deeds and glorify your Father in heaven.” This calls us to live as examples of God’s goodness, making our protection a witness to others.

Conclusion: Making Family Prayer Your Foundation

These twenty-five prayers represent more than words – they’re declarations of faith and trust in God’s faithfulness to your family. As you begin this new year, consider these practical steps to make prayer more consistent, personal, and transformative:
Create a Family Prayer Rhythm: Establish specific times for family devotion – perhaps Sunday evenings or daily before dinner. Consistency builds spiritual momentum and makes prayer a natural part of your family culture.
Personalize Your Prayers: While these prayers provide structure, add your family’s specific needs, dreams, and circumstances. God delights in the details of our lives and wants to hear about everything that matters to you.
Journal Your Prayer Journey: Keep a family prayer journal where you record requests, answered prayers, and spiritual insights. This creates a powerful record of God’s faithfulness and builds faith for future challenges.
Involve Everyone: Let each family member contribute prayer requests and take turns leading prayer. Children often pray with remarkable faith and honesty that can inspire adults.
Connect Prayer with Action: When you pray for health, make healthy choices. When you pray for finances, practice good stewardship. Faith and works together create powerful transformation.
